Opened in 1902 as Bexhill by the South Eastern & Chatham Railway as the terminus of its branch line from Crowhurst, this station closed in 1964. It had been renamed Bexhill West in 1929. Forecourt. The interior of the station, behind the building, has been redeveloped.
